Innovation

The ongoing transition in the energy sector has propelled innovation in the power sector to the fore. It has been estimated that accelerated innovation in power supply technologies and business models for energy efficiency will be worth €70 billion to the EU economy by 2030. Additional benefits are also expected in energy security, lower system costs, and consumer convenience.

Innovation represents an important part European power companies’ budgets, in spite of the current economic difficulties of the sector. The total R&D expenditure of 13 major European utilities reached €1.4 billion in 2014.
